A concentrate of patented technologies: Flo2at

We use hydroponics in all our indoor vegetable gardens: plants float and develop their root systems in water. To enhance the performance of our gardens, we have created and developed the patented Flo2at system.

Cultivation takes place on floater to optimize root oxygenation. As a result, the plant breathes more easily and draws in greater quantities of essential elements present in the water (oxygen, minerals, etc.).
